A critical 0‑click vulnerability in the OpenClaw local WebSocket gateway allowed attacker-controlled web pages to connect to localhost, brute-force gateway credentials (bypassing rate limits), register as trusted devices without user confirmation, and obtain full control of AI agents and connected devices—enabling credential theft, file exfiltration, Slack/API key harvesting, and remote command execution; OpenClaw patched the issue (version 2026.2.25+) within 24 hours.
